Output d26331dabdc9058711489092fb48691b8be6b003bce65bc264c96907e469d362:0

value
102951
script pubkey
OP_0 OP_PUSHBYTES_20 5e12f29c8a13e3e24a2b04db922439d5db006553
address
bc1qtcf098y2z037yj3tqndeyfpe6hdsqe2nmgzqqu
transaction
d26331dabdc9058711489092fb48691b8be6b003bce65bc264c96907e469d362
confirmations
185165
spent
true